META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

3,068 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Meta Platforms (Facebook) (META)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$344B — up 75% from $197B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 510 funds opened new META positions and 144 closed out — a net gain of 366 holders — while 1,056 added to existing stakes and 1,271 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$1.6B. The largest seller was Amundi, cutting an estimated $1.03B.
